如何用ssh登录服务器配置

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    SSH(Secure Shell)是一种加密的远程连接协议,用于安全地登录服务器并进行配置。通过SSH登录服务器可以远程管理服务器,执行命令、上传下载文件等操作。以下是使用SSH登录服务器并进行配置的步骤:

    1. 确保你拥有服务器的SSH登录凭证:通常是服务器的IP地址、端口号(默认是22)、用户名和密码。一些服务器还需要提供SSH密钥对。

    2. 打开终端(对于Windows用户,可以使用PuTTY等SSH客户端软件)。

    3. 输入以下命令以SSH登录服务器:

    ssh [用户名]@[服务器IP地址] -p [端口号]
    

    例如:

    ssh ubuntu@192.168.0.1 -p 22
    

    如果使用SSH密钥对登录,可以使用以下命令:

    ssh -i [私钥文件路径] [用户名]@[服务器IP地址] -p [端口号]
    

    例如:

    ssh -i ~/.ssh/private_key.pem ubuntu@192.168.0.1 -p 22
    
    1. 输入密码(或者如果使用SSH密钥对登录,则无需输入密码)确认登录。

    2. 登录成功后,你将看到类似于命令行界面的服务器终端。

    接下来,你可以按照需要进行服务器配置。以下是一些建议:

    • 安全配置:更新服务器操作系统和软件包,设置防火墙规则,禁用root登录和密码登录,启用SSH密钥登录。

    • 网络配置:配置网络接口、IP地址、子网掩码、网关等。

    • 用户和权限管理:添加、删除和修改用户账户,设置用户权限和文件权限。

    • 服务配置:安装和配置所需的服务,例如Web服务器(如Apache或Nginx)和数据库服务器(如MySQL或PostgreSQL)。

    • 日志和监控:设置日志记录,监控服务器资源使用情况,并配置警报系统。

    完成配置后,你可以使用exit命令退出SSH会话。

    使用SSH登录服务器并进行配置可以实现远程管理服务器的目的,同时也保证了连接的安全性。定期更新服务器配置可确保服务器的稳定性和安全性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用SSH(Secure Shell)登录服务器可以通过终端(命令行界面)远程连接到服务器并进行配置。以下是使用SSH登录服务器并进行配置的基本步骤:

    1. 打开终端
      在本地电脑上打开终端(Windows操作系统上通常是命令提示符,Linux和Mac操作系统上是终端应用程序)。

    2. 输入SSH命令
      输入以下命令来连接服务器:

      ssh username@server_address
      

      其中,"username"是你在服务器上的用户名,"server_address"是服务器的IP地址或域名。

    3. 验证身份
      输入你的密码来验证身份,然后按Enter键。

    4. 配置服务器
      登录成功后,你可以在终端上执行各种命令来配置服务器。以下是一些常见的配置操作:

      • 安装软件
        使用包管理工具(如yum、apt-get等)安装需要的软件,例如:

        sudo apt-get install package_name
        

        或者

        sudo yum install package_name
        
      • 修改配置文件
        使用文本编辑器修改服务器上的配置文件,例如:

        sudo nano /path/to/config_file
        

        或者

        sudo vi /path/to/config_file
        
      • 启动、停止或重启服务
        使用系统命令来控制各种服务的状态,例如:

        sudo systemctl start service_name
        

        或者

        sudo service service_name start
        
      • 设置防火墙规则
        使用防火墙工具(如iptables、ufw等)设置服务器的防火墙规则,例如:

        sudo iptables -A INPUT -p tcp --dport port_number -j ACCEPT
        

        或者

        sudo ufw allow port_number
        
    5. 退出SSH连接
      当你完成配置并且不再需要和服务器通信时,可以输入以下命令来退出SSH连接:

      exit
      

    通过以上步骤,你就可以使用SSH登录服务器,并进行配置。请根据你的具体需求和服务器配置来操作,并确保谨慎执行命令,以免对服务器产生不良影响。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    使用SSH登录服务器与配置是一种安全且常见的远程管理方式。下面是一步一步的操作流程来解释如何使用SSH登录服务器并进行配置。

    1. 下载和安装SSH客户端
      首先,您需要在本地计算机上安装SSH客户端。对于Windows用户,可以下载并安装PuTTY;对于Mac和Linux用户,则可以使用原生的终端应用程序。

    2. 获取服务器的SSH登录信息
      在连接服务器之前,您需要获取服务器的SSH登录信息,包括IP地址、用户名和密码。有时您还需要提供特定的端口号。这些信息通常由服务器管理员提供。

    3. 打开SSH客户端
      在您的本地计算机上打开SSH客户端应用程序(如PuTTY)或终端。

    4. 连接服务器
      输入服务器的IP地址和端口号(如果有的话)来建立与服务器的SSH连接。对于PuTTY用户,可以将IP地址输入到“Host Name”字段中,然后点击“Open”按钮。对于终端用户,可以使用命令ssh username@ip_address -p port_number来连接服务器,将username替换为您的用户名,ip_address替换为服务器的IP地址,port_number替换为服务器的端口号。

    5. 输入用户名和密码
      如果连接成功,SSH客户端将提示您输入用户名和密码来登录服务器。输入您的用户名和密码,并按下“Enter”键。

    6. 进行配置
      一旦成功登录服务器,您可以执行各种配置操作。以下是一些常见的配置任务:

      • 修改用户密码:使用passwd命令来更改当前用户的密码。
      • 更改主机名:使用hostnamectl set-hostname new_hostname命令来更改服务器的主机名,将new_hostname替换为新的主机名。
      • 安装软件包:使用适合您服务器操作系统的包管理器(如apt、yum或dnf)来安装新的软件包。
      • 配置网络:使用ifconfigip addr命令来查看和配置网络接口。
      • 配置防火墙规则:使用防火墙管理工具(如iptables、ufw或firewalld)来配置服务器的防火墙规则。

      请注意,在进行重要的配置更改之前,请确保理解和了解相关操作的影响,并备份服务器数据以防万一。

    7. 退出服务器
      当您完成所有配置任务时,可以使用命令exit来退出服务器。然后,关闭SSH客户端应用程序。

    这是使用SSH登录服务器并进行配置的基本步骤。根据您的需求,可能还需要进行其他特定的配置操作。在任何时候,请参考相关文档或咨询服务器管理员以获取更详细的指导。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部